What is a 341 Meeting? Named for the section in which it's housed in the Bankruptcy code, a 341 meeting, also called the meeting of creditors, is an opportunity for the bankruptcy trustee to ask you about your bankruptcy filing as well as for any of your creditors to come forward and object to your request for relief. That may sound scary, but keep reading: it's not as bad as you think!
The 341 meeting may be the only hearing that you will have related to your Arizona Chapter 7 bankruptcy. There is no need to worry or be anxious about this meeting; the bankruptcy trustee ...
